How long can you hold this car for me after the deposit is paid?

Our standard holding period is 3 business days after the deposit is paid (based on the timestamp of the payment slip). The domestic used car market in China moves very quickly, and if we do not receive the bank message confirming the deposit within the specified time, the system will automatically release the hold, and the vehicle will be re-listed for public sale.

Are you responsible for re-spraying the chassis anti-rust coating (armor) if it is eroded by salt spray during sea transport?

No, we are not responsible. The high salt and humidity of the marine environment do have an impact on the chassis surface. We recommend buyers in tropical islands or countries that use salt for winter snow removal to perform a thorough chassis anti-rust spray locally immediately after the vehicle arrives.

When B2B buyers make bulk purchases, can they request to combine the accessory costs and vehicle price on the same commercial invoice to reduce overall tariffs?

No, this is a serious customs violation. Complete vehicles (HS Code 8703) and auto parts (HS Code 8708, etc.) are subject to completely different import tax rates. Combining them on one invoice could lead to the invoice being returned by customs and may expose you to tax fraud accusations at the destination port.
